Deletion of UL21 causes a delay in the early stages of the herpes simplex virus 1 replication cycle
Authors:Mbong Ekaette F  Woodley Lucille  Frost Elizabeth  Baines Joel D  Duffy Carol
Institution:Department of Biological Sciences, University of Alabama, Tuscaloosa, Alabama, USA.
Abstract:The herpes simplex virus 1 (HSV-1) U(L)21 gene encodes a 62-kDa tegument protein with homologs in the alpha-, beta-, and gammaherpesvirus subfamilies. In the present study, we characterized a novel U(L)21-null virus and its genetic repair to determine whether this protein plays a role in early stages of the HSV-1 replication cycle. Single-step growth analyses, protein synthesis time courses, and mRNA quantifications indicated that the absence of U(L)21 results in a delay early in the HSV-1 replication cycle.
